According to Grips Intelligence in-store data covering January 1 to June 30, 2026 across Ace Hardware, Lowe's, and Home Depot, Plaskolite—a privately held company owned by Pritzker Private Capital and thus without a public stock ticker—overall grew revenue 5.5% during the period. Ace Hardware dominated the brand's offline sales mix with an 88.1% revenue share, far ahead of Lowe's at 10.7% and Home Depot at just 1.2%. The average product price landed at $40.58, though the most recent month showed softening momentum with pricing dipping to $36.11, a 3.2% month-over-month decline. Revenue also cooled in the latest month, falling 7.4% versus the prior month despite the positive first-half trajectory. These Grips Intelligence datapoints point to a brand heavily concentrated in a single retail channel while navigating recent price and revenue pressure.
